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Saltaire to Prittlewell start from as little as £20.70

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Saltaire to Prittlewell start from £75.10 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Saltaire to Prittlewell are available for £101.00 one way

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Saltaire Station

Although Saltaire station is not equipped with a ticket office, there's no need to worry. Ticket machines are readily available for passengers to collect tickets and on-the-go purchases are made convenient with card-only acceptance due to past incidents of vandalism. For those utilizing smartcards, there's good news: Saltaire provides both issuance and validation services. Induction loops are in place to assist those with hearing impairments.

The station's focus on accessibility is evident, with parts offering step-free access, although travelers should note the challenges posed by the cobbled streets and the high camber between platform and train. Assistance is often provided by train conductors, ensuring you can board with ease. Despite the lack of staff presence, help can be requested through the helpline at 08002006060.

Getting Around Saltaire and Beyond

Transportation options abound for onward travel from Saltaire. Buses pick up and drop off at nearby stops on Caroline Street, just a stone's throw from the station. For those preferring personalized transit options, taxi services can be arranged through Cab4You. Bus services are plentiful with helpful information available through Busline at 0871 200 2233. Bicycle hire is not facilitated at the station itself, so consider alternative nearby options if you're itching for a ride on two wheels.

Facilities and Ticketing at Prittlewell Station

Prittlewell Train Station features an organised system for ticket buying and collection. With a ticket office operational from 06:00 to 13:00 on weekdays and Saturdays, you can conveniently manage your travel plans. If you prefer using ticket machines, they’re readily accessible, even for those requiring accessible options. Smartcard users will find validators ready for use, making your commute even more seamless.

Accessibility and Support

For travelers requiring assistance, the station ensures there’s help available. Customer help points are available during the ticket office hours, and staff assistance can be requested in advance using National Rail’s Passenger Assist service. While the station features partial step-free access, it's essential to note that step-free travel is limited to the London-bound platform. A significant plus is the availability of ramps for train boarding, accommodating passengers with mobility needs.

Amenities and Services

While Prittlewell Station is not bursting with amenities, necessitating no onsite refreshment facilities, shops, or ATMs, what it offers is simplicity and functionally driven connectivity. Wi-Fi is available, so you can stay connected while you wait for your train. Cycling enthusiasts will appreciate the provision of bicycle storage within the forecourt, although it’s worth noting that currently there’s no CCTV or cycle hire facilities.

Navigating Onward Travel

If Prittlewell is merely a stop on your broader journey, onward travel connections are conveniently situated. Bus services link to the delightful environs of Southend, and being a PlusBus location, several local buses are accessible for ease of continuation. During rail service disruptions, replacement buses are available from East Street and Station Approach, ensuring you reach your destination without unnecessary delays.
